Save the Children Alliance
 
 
Our Mission

Save the Children fights for children's rights. We deliver immediate and lasting improvements to children’s lives worldwide.

Our Vision

Save the Children works for:

  • a world which respects and values each child
  • a world which listens to children and learns
  • a world where all children have hope and opportunity
What Sets Us Apart

Save the Children is the world’s largest independent organisation for children, making a difference to children’s lives in over 120 countries.

From emergency relief to long-term development, Save the Children helps children to achieve a happy, healthy and secure childhood. Save the Children listens to children, involves children and ensures their views are taken into account. Save the Children secures and protects children’s rights – to food, shelter, health care, education and freedom from violence, abuse and exploitation.
